What Makes an Online Casino Trustworthy?
Trust begins with transparency. A reputable casino should clearly display its licensing information, ownership details, terms and conditions, privacy policy, and responsible gambling guidance. Licensing does not guarantee that every experience will be perfect, but it indicates that the operator is subject to regulatory requirements and ongoing oversight.
Security is equally important. Look for encrypted connections, secure account login, identity verification procedures, and established payment providers. Reliable operators also explain how personal information is collected, stored, and used. Players should avoid websites that request unusual payments, hide important terms, or make unrealistic promises about guaranteed winnings.
Comparing Games, Software, and Mobile Access
A broad game library allows players to enjoy different styles without constantly changing platforms. Online casinos commonly offer classic and video slots, jackpot games, blackjack, roulette, baccarat, poker variants, and live dealer tables. However, quantity should not be the only consideration. Game quality, fairness, loading speed, and software reputation are just as important.
Key Features Worth Checking
- Games from established software providers with published return-to-player information.
- Responsive design that works smoothly on smartphones and tablets.
- Live casino tables with clear video, stable streaming, and professional dealers.
- Search and filter tools that make large game libraries easier to navigate.
- Demo or free-play options where available, allowing users to understand gameplay before wagering.
Mobile compatibility is now essential. A well-designed mobile casino should provide simple navigation, readable menus, quick game loading, and secure access without forcing players to compromise on important account functions. Before playing on a phone, use a trusted network and keep the operating system and browser updated.
Bonuses and Terms That Matter
Promotions can increase entertainment value, but their real benefit depends on the conditions attached. A welcome offer may include a deposit match, free spins, cashback, or loyalty rewards. Always read the wagering requirement, eligible games, maximum bet rule, contribution percentages, expiry period, and maximum withdrawal limits before accepting a bonus.
| Promotion Detail | Why It Matters |
|---|---|
| Wagering requirement | Shows how many times qualifying funds must be played through. |
| Eligible games | Explains which games count toward completing the offer. |
| Maximum bet | Sets the highest permitted stake while bonus funds are active. |
| Expiry date | Indicates how long players have to meet the promotional conditions. |
| Withdrawal rules | Clarifies identity checks, limits, and restrictions on bonus winnings. |
Responsible players treat bonuses as optional extras rather than guaranteed profit. If the terms are difficult to understand, contact customer support before depositing. A transparent operator should provide a direct answer without pressure or vague language.
Deposits, Withdrawals, and Customer Support
Payment flexibility is another major factor when selecting a casino. Common methods include bank cards, bank transfers, electronic wallets, prepaid solutions, and sometimes digital currencies. Compare processing times, minimum and maximum limits, transaction fees, and verification requirements. Deposits are often instant, while withdrawals may take longer because of security checks.
Customer support should be available through practical channels such as live chat, email, or telephone. Test the support team with a simple question before registering. Fast, polite, and informative replies suggest that assistance will be available if a payment, account, or technical issue occurs.
Responsible Gaming Should Come First
Casino games are designed for entertainment, not as a reliable way to earn income. Set a budget before playing and never use money needed for rent, bills, savings, or essential expenses. Time limits can also help prevent extended sessions and impulsive decisions.
- Set deposit, loss, and session limits whenever the casino provides them.
- Never chase losses by increasing stakes or borrowing money.
- Take regular breaks and keep gambling separate from work or personal responsibilities.
- Use self-exclusion tools if gambling is becoming difficult to control.
- Seek confidential professional support if gaming causes financial or emotional harm.
Players should also check age and location requirements before opening an account. Legal rules differ between countries and regions, so always use licensed services that are permitted to operate where you live.
